    Job Description

    TheRadiologic Technologistsperforms medical imaging procedures for diagnosis or treating medical problems in a clinical setting which consists of routine radiography. The Radiologic Technologists use their expertise and knowledge of patient handling physics anatomy physiology pathology and radiology to assess patients develop optimal radiologic techniques or plans and evaluate resulting radiographic images. The radiologic Technologist also performs minor clinic clerical duties.

    The Radiologic Technologist reports to the Medical Imaging Manager and has an indirect reporting relationship to the Clinic Administrator. As assigned this position will float to any of our 7 clinic locations to provide coverage during staff absences and position vacancies.

    Required Qualifications

    Graduate from an approved school of Radiologic Technology Program

    0-2 years experience in a hospital or clinic

    American Registry of Radiologic Technologist ARRT

    Licensed by the State of Wisconsin

    Preferred Qualifications

    Previous Radiologic Technologist experience. Knowledge of Epic Ambulatory EMR RIS and PACS
